New environmental problems exist today which have increased the demand for sustainable building and lead to the invention of 'green' technologies such as green roofs, solar panels, and water collection and storage systems. Today, due to mechanically conditioned spaces and other social factors, buildings designs have become independent from their natural environment and forgotten many of the important 'green' building techniques of the past. In addition, commercial industries of the past were dependent on specific climate conditions which in turn began to define the region's character. Designers of the past had to create buildings that addressed their climate zone or else survival through a harsh winter or an extremely hot summer might not be possible. In fact, these structures depended on its natural surroundings and this dependence informed the architectural expression. Before the age of electric heating and cooling systems and thermal insulation, buildings were designed to take advantage of their natural surroundings. The final result being a building whose expression reflects a new regional vernacular. This analysis of ancient building strategies will examine similar climate areas to the Southeast United States and combined the information with modern 'green' technologies. This topic will involve an analysis of architecture of the past to reveal how sustainable design techniques were dependent on the natural environment of a specific climate region.
